Iowa Democrats postpone state convention

WE'VE MOVED! Democratic Convention Watch is now at http://www.DemocraticConventionWatch.com

The State Democratic convention, which had been set for Saturday in downtown Des Moines, has been postponed as the state struggles to deal with widespread flooding.

Iowa Democratic Party spokeswoman Brooke Borkenhagen said they were trying to find a new date and venue for the event. - Quad City Times
For those still keeping track, the resolution of John Edwards' projected 3 statewide delegates, as well as the naming of Iowa's add-on superdelegate, will understandably have to wait.

The Republicans have postponed their convention also.

Our thoughts are with the people of Iowa during these tough times.

Update: The Iowa Democratic Party has rescheduled its convention to June 28.
